原文:C语言 · 回文数 · 基础练习

问题描述 是一个非常特殊的数,它从左边读和从右边读是一样的,编程求所有这样的四位十进制数。 输出格式 按从小到大的顺序输出满足条件的四位十进制数。 代码如下: 注意:这里要提醒一下读者:蓝桥杯都是在线提交,输出一组数时默认一个数占一行,而不是空格隔开 不能不说 这尼玛坑爹啊 include lt stdio.h gt int main int a,b,c,d for int i i lt i a ...

2016-12-29 19:55 0 1609 推荐指数:

查看详情

回文C语言

题目描述 若一个(首位不为0)从左到右读与从右到左读都是一样,这个数就叫做回文,例如12521就是一个回文。 给定一个正整数,把它的每一个位上的数字倒过来排列组成一个新,然后与原相加,如果是回文则停止,如果不是,则重复这个操作,直到和为回文为止。给定的数本身不为回文 ...

Sat Dec 03 06:26:00 CST 2016 0 2104
C语言递归实现判断回文

实现算法:定义一个全局变量作为字符数组的标识指针,依次对比首元素和尾元素,如果出现不匹配就返回异常并结束当前运行的函数。 递归时改变传入长度的数值实现首元素和尾元素的比较,递归以标识指针和改变后的l ...

Fri Nov 13 07:12:00 CST 2020 0 717
C语言程序设计】C语言回文怎么求?

问题描述 打印所有不超过n(取n<256)的其平方具有对称性质的(也称回文)。 问题分析 对于要判定的n计算出其平方后(存于a),按照“回文”的定义要将最高位与最低位、次高位与次低位……进行比较,若彼此相等则为回文。此算法需要知道平方的位数,再一一将每一位分解、比较 ...

Sat Feb 06 23:32:00 CST 2021 0 502
C语言判断一个是不是回文

所谓回文,就是说一个数字从左边读和从右边读的结果是一模一样的,例如12321。判断给出的整数是否是回文;若是,则输出该整数各位数字之和;否则输出该不是一个回文。 原理大致为:任何一个除以10的余数就是该最后一位;任何一个除以10的商就是排除掉最后一位后的;所以 ,一个1234 ...

Thu May 07 20:56:00 CST 2020 0 798
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M